Epidermal Inclusion Cyst Presenting as a Palpable Scrotal Mass
We report a scrotal epidermal inclusion cyst located outside the median raphe which a rare entity in the absence of trauma and few cases have been reported. 47 year old male presents with a complaint of right sided testicular swelling and discomfort.
